actually if you dont own any hots yet, you would probably be much better off starting out with an arboreal species over a monocled. most arboreal species such as eyelashes, white lips, and other arborial vipers have a much less toxic venom than monocleds, and in fact are often recommended as first hots. i know that a lot of people start out with eyelashes and white lips. these small arboreal vipers will give you a feel for hots in general and will act much more like a pigmy, which will mean there is less of a chance of you getting tagged. cobras act NOTHING like vipers. unless you can interact with a monocled (or at least some other sort of cobra) under a mentor, i really would advise you against getting any naja to start with.
